JUSTICE MADHURESH PRASAD ORAL ORDER 26-02-2019 Counter affidavit has been filed on behalf of the respondent no. 2. Specific assertion has been made that the grievance of the petitioner no. 1 and 2 has been redressed as they have been appointed on Clause IV posts and posted at Government Polytechnic, Bhagalpur vide order no. 45 dated 21.12.2017 and order no. 47 dated 21.12.2017 respectively. Copies of the appointment orders have been placed on record by way of Annexure A and B to the counter affidavit filed by the respondent no. 2. In view of such development during
Patna High Court CWJC No.5801 of 2015(2) dt.26-02-2019 2/2 pendency of the writ petition, it is submitted by counsel for the State that the writ petition has become infructuous. Since none appears on behalf of the petitioners, without going into merits of the submission made by the State counsel, writ petition is dismissed for want of prosecution.
